District to get federal funding
The School District of Poynette is slated to receive $303,014 from the federal government to help fund staff positions for the next two school years.

Questions raised about 'street dance'
Concerns are rising on a planned street dance to be held following the Poynette High School homecoming football game on Sept. 24. The Poynette Athletic Booster Club wants to use the event as a fundraiser, and Poynette trustees approved use of Pauquette Park last week.

Feingold vs. Johnson on free trade
Ron Johnson says free trade has been successful for Wisconsin's economy. He says that in a free-market system, there are winners and losers. Feingold has always opposed free trade agreements, because the losers far exceed the winners.
